Fuel Your Mobility - Men's Guide to Optimal Joint Health

Aligning your lifestyle with joint-supporting practices is essential for men who engage in a high level of physical activity. As we progress through life, our joints naturally experience friction. By embracing a holistic approach that encompasses diet, targeted activities, and recovery time, you can strengthen your joints, improve mobility, and reduce the risk of future pain or restrictions.

  • Focus on a healthy diet rich in minerals to combat inflammation.
  • Perform regular resistance exercises to build the muscles that support your joints.
  • Include low-impact exercises like swimming, cycling, or walking into your routine to improve joint flexibility and range of motion.

Achieving Peak Performance: Best Vitamins for Healthy Joints

Maintaining healthy joints is essential for optimal mobility and an active lifestyle. As we age, our joint health can naturally decline, leading to discomfort and limitations. Fortunately, certain vitamins play a crucial role in supporting strong, flexible joints and mitigating the effects of wear and tear.

Incorporating a balanced diet rich in these essential nutrients can greatly enhance joint health and maximize your performance.

  • Ascorbic Acid| A potent antioxidant that helps produce collagen, a protein vital for healthy cartilage and connective tissue.
  • Chondroitin| Promotes the production of cartilage, cushioning joints and reducing friction.
  • Vitamin D| Essential for calcium absorption, which is required for bone health and joint strength.

Embrace Aging|Maintaining Flexibility and Joint Strength

As we transition into later life, it's crucial to emphasize maintaining their flexibility and joint strength. Consistent exercise can help improve mobility, reduce the risk of injury, and promote overall well-being.

Consider including tai chi into your plan. Activities like this can gently extend muscles and boost joint mobility.

Additionally, try strength training exercises that target major muscle groups. This will strengthen bone density and support your joints.

Remember to talk to your healthcare provider before starting any new exercise program, especially if you have pre-existing medical issues.
